Soup Plate
1760–1770
Diameter: 22.9 cm (9 in.)
Location: Not on view
- arms of Saldanha de Alberquerque. Made for Portuguese market. Said to have been presented by an Indian Maharajah to a member of this family active in Indo-Portuguese affairs. Bishop's hat over ams indicated he was an ecclesiastic. Ex-Collection: Helena Woolworth McCann.
